[QUOTE=justin1992;32751151]"Nah man, fuck putting my intake in a reasonable place, Imma just put it on top of the tire and put a bypass on it so when it rains and ruins the air intake i can still suck up air, whatev man i don give a fuk" [editline]12th October 2011[/editline] My point being you wouldn't NEED an air bypass valve if you would have put it the same spot everyone else does...Inside the engine compartment [editline]12th October 2011[/editline] [img]http://puu.sh/6UDm[/img] Hm...[/QUOTE] I've been considering a cold air intake for my motor, not to be confused with a short ram intake. For a cold air feed on a lude you need to cut through the wheelarch and feed the pipe down through there whereas a short ram sits in the engine bay. Pics: Short Ram [img]http://i14.photobucket.com/albums/a309/CUL8R/Glass%20factory%20pics/P1010001.jpg[/img] Cold air feed: [img]http://www.racinghonda.com/pictures/4thgen/CAI/DSCF7062.jpg[/img] [img]http://www.racinghonda.com/pictures/4thgen/CAI/DSCF7059.jpg[/img] I've been told of good proven gains as it's feeding direct cold air rather than warm air from the engine bay. Not quite as bad as the chevvy positioning but is it a box worthy idea?
Not worth the gain. Looking like a dork and risking hydrolocking... Really worth the 1-2hp you'll gain from moving the intake piping into the fenderwell?
